What is a Fading Fence?
Defining the Paling Fence
A paling fence is essentially a type of fence built from vertical wooden boards or "pales" that are closely spaced to offer privacy while enabling some airflow. Generally made from lumber, these fences offer a rustic appeal that blends magnificently with natural landscapes.

Understanding Wood Types Used in Fading Fences
Popular Wood Choices for Paling Fences
When it comes to building your paling fence, the kind of wood you select plays a vital function in both look and price. Typical choices consist of:
- Pine: Economical and commonly readily available but needs treatment versus rot. Cedar: Naturally resistant to decay; offers longevity. Redwood: Premium choice known for its charm and durability.
The Rate Spectrum for Various Woods
|Kind of Wood|Price per Linear Foot|Life expectancy|Attributes|| --------------|----------------------|----------|------------------|| Pine|$2 - $5|5-10 years|Affordable & & lightweight|| Cedar|$5 - $15|15-30 years|Rot-resistant & & stunning|| Redwood|$15 - $25|20-50 years|High-end look & & long-lasting|

Average Labor Costs for Professionals
The typical expense for working with experts can range from $30 to $70 per hour depending on place and know-how. A normal setup might take anywhere from 6 hours to several days based on different elements such as surface difficulty or weather conditions.

Maintenance Expenses Over Time
Routine Maintenance Requirements
Regular maintenance helps extend the life-span of your paling fence. This consists of:
Cleaning debris regularly. Applying sealant every couple of years. Inspecting for rot or damage periodically.Average Annual Maintenance Costs
On average, anticipate annual maintenance expenses to range from $100 to $300 depending on the specific care required by your picked wood type.

FAQ Section
What's the average lifespan of a wood paling fence?
Typically between 10 to thirty years depending on wood type and upkeep practices.
How often should I stain my wood paling fence?
Every 3-- 5 years is ideal unless wear occurs sooner due to weather conditions.
Can I paint my wood fading fencing?
Absolutely! Simply guarantee correct surface preparation before using paint.
Do I need permission before installing a new fence?
Yes! Constantly examine regional policies regarding permits before starting any deal with fencing projects.
What's better: treated pine or untreated cedar?
Treated pine is less expensive but may not last as long as neglected cedar which has natural decay resistance.
How much should I budget plan for expert installation?
Expect anywhere from 10%-- 50% more than product costs based upon complexities involved!
